Transaction 9e31303776c916f67f32bc6f08cbdb2af88734400e1d2e8c43b53894c3a47b3f
1 Input
1 Output
-
9e31303776c916f67f32bc6f08cbdb2af88734400e1d2e8c43b53894c3a47b3f:0
- value
- 18490
- script pubkey
- OP_0 OP_PUSHBYTES_20 1abe8efe084b3c4572f1a9a37335c65442bb053e
- address
- bc1qr2lgalsgfv7y2uh34x3hxdwx23ptkpf74petft